Autoplay Mode

Autoplay mode provides a seamless transition between your portable and home audio experience. You can walk in the door,
place your device in the SONOS DOCK, and the music that's playing on your iPod or iPhone automatically starts playing over
Sonos. You will be prompted to select an Autoplay room during setup. You can change the autoplay room anytime (see
"Changing DOCK Settings" on page 3.)
While your device is seated in the DOCK in autoplay mode, you can select music directly from the device. You can switch to
accessory mode at any time to make music selections and control playback using a Sonos controller.
• To switch to accessory mode, simply start browsing the music on your iPhone or iPod using any Sonos controller —
playback control automatically shifts to your Sonos system.
• To return to autoplay mode, simply undock and redock your device.
Note: When your iPhone is seated in the DOCK in Autoplay mode, the ringtone for incoming
calls will play through your Sonos system. If you do not want to hear ringtones or other
system sounds associated with your device, simply set the iPhone ringer switch (located on
the left side of your phone) to silent.

Selecting Music

You can select music directly from your device when it is seated in the DOCK (autoplay mode), or you can use any Sonos
controller to make music selections and control playback (accessory mode).
